DESCRIPTION:The Office of Sponsored Programs (OSP) holds a monthly meeting called the Research Administrators Network (RAN). All research administration faculty and staff attend this meeting in which we discuss University and policy changes\, internal processes and procedures\, sponsor guidelines regarding proposal applications\, and award terms and conditions. The meeting agenda changes each month based on what is happening internally and externally with our sponsors. All faculty and staff are allowed to submit questions and agenda items. The meeting allows both OSP and the Office of Contacts and Grant Accounting (CGA) to provide regular updates and training to faculty and staff\, ensuring we are all on the same page. Research Administrators can use this forum to network and build relationships that will support their development and growth in research administration. OSP disseminates all information shared during this meeting in writing to participants\, so they have the information they need to complete their work. The meetings also help to facilitate a more team-oriented environment where we can work together to solve problems\, create procedures\, and gain a better understanding and appreciation for the people we work with whose work overlaps and intersects with ours. \n\n\n\nThe RAN “Lunch and Learn” Series: We encourage all staff who have attended a training or conference to volunteer to present a topic session to RAN. We call this the RAN “Lunch and Learn Series.” Sessions occur during the summer months of June and July. We typically hold four sessions on different research administration topics\, two per month.

DESCRIPTION:Join the North Carolina Military Business Center and the North Carolina Coalition of Defense Researchers for a Science and Technology webinar discussion with the U.S. Army Medical Capability Development Integration Directorate (MED CDID). This webinar will be held on Aug 6\, 2025\, from 2:00 p.m. to 3:30 p.m. \n\n\n\nLTC Susan Gosine\, Chief\, Science and Technology Branch\, Concepts Division\, will discuss current and future technologies of interest to the Army medical community. \n\n\n\nThe mission of MED CDID is to develop concepts\, learn\, and integrate capabilities to improve medical support to our Army and the joint force. MED CDID’s Science and Technology Branch finds current and emerging technologies that improve our medical capabilities on the future battlefield from now to the year 2040 and beyond. \n\n\n\nSpecific topics related to medical science and technology will include:  \n\n\n\n\nClothing and textiles\n\n\n\nHuman performance monitoring\n\n\n\nMedical devices\n\n\n\nSynthetic biology (and similar fields of science)\n\n\n\n\nThis is a free webinar; however\, pre-registration is required to receive the virtual platform credentials. DESCRIPTION:Time: 6:00 – 8:00 pm\, drinks and raffle begins at 5:30pm \n\n\n\nTicket options (non-refundable):\n\n\n\n\nSingle ticket – $75 ($83.50 options to donate processing fee)\n\n\n\nCouples Ticket – $100 (117.00 options to donate processing fee)\n\n\n\n\nLink to donation site: https://www.alumni.uncg.edu/s/1659/index.aspx?sid=1659&gid=2&pgid=488&cid=1280&appealcode=RE-WEB&SOLORG=RE&SOLSOURCE=WEB&dids=718.553&sort=1&bledit=1 UNCG’s Center for New North Carolinians exists to build bridges and facilitate access for immigrants and refugees in Guilford County and the surrounding areas.  We do this through Community-based outreach initiatives and programming to help immigrants and refugees build their capacity to navigate complex systems in their new home. The CNNC is hosting its first ever fundraising gala and dinner. We will spend the evening celebrating the immigrant community of Greensboro through music\, dance\, and the sharing of stories.  Guests will hear the stories of guests of honor about their journey and how CNNC came alongside them as they made Greensboro their home.  Former director and founder of the CNNC\, Dr. Raleigh Bailey\, will share the history\, importance\, and vision of the CNNC. There will also be performances by local dance troupes and a raffle of items donated by our community. We hope to see you there and join us for this celebration of community and our future together. \n\n\n\nIf you have questions about the Beyond Barriers: A Night of Unity – A Fundraising Gala for UNCG’s Center for New North Carolinians\, or if you would like to be an event sponsor\, please contact Rob Cassell at recassell@uncg.edu. \n\n\n\nIf you have any questions about your registration or payment\, please contact Nichole McGill at nmcgill@serve.org.  \n\n\n\n*ALL fields on the registration page must be completed in order to register.
